Lets get back to the business of hoops now and our annual Tennessee Prep Hoops All-Region squads. There will be a 10 man All-Region team with an MVP, plus 7 honorable mention players.
Region 3AAA
District 5AAA Regular Season Champions: East Hamilton
District 5AAA Tournament Champions: Cleveland
Projected 5AAA District MVP: Cam Montgomery (East Hamilton)
District 6AAA Regular Season Champions: Stone Memorial
District 6AAA Tournament Champions: Stone Memorial
Projected 6AAA District MVP: Grant Slatten (White County)
Region 3AAA All-Region Team
Jacobi Wood (Cleveland) MVP
Justin Hedrick (Stone Memorial)
Grant Slatten (White County)
Cam Montgomery (East Hamilton)
Alex Garrett (Cookeville)
Quante Berry (Bradley Central)
Jamal Walker (East Hamilton)
Isaiah Johnson (Cleveland)
Brett Newcomb (Stone Memorial)
Kade Clark (White County)
Honorable Mention
Grant Hurst (Cleveland)
Tray Curry (Bradley Central)
Morrell Schramm (East Hamilton)
Kaleb Laws (Rhea County)
Jordan Munck (Walker Valley)
Tyler Peel (McMinn County)
Jack Eldridge (Stone Memorial)
Region 4AAA
District 7AAA Regular Season Champions: Riverdale
District 7AAA Tournament Champions: Oakland
Projected 7AAA District MVP: Deron Perry (Riverdale)
District 8AAA Regular Season Champions: Coffee County
District 8AAA Tournament Champions: Columbia Central
Projected 8AAA District MVP: Darius Rozier (Coffee County)
Region 4AAA All-Region Team
Deron Perry (Riverdale)
Jaden Jamison (Oakland)
Darius Rozier (Coffee County)
Jalen Page (Blackman)
Elijah Cobb (Riverdale)
Dontavious Brown (Columbia Central)
Tyler Erdman (Siegel)
De'Arre McDonald (Oakland)
Matthew Schneider (Siegel)
Ray Tyler (Oakland)
Honorable Mention
Jordan Burchfield (Blackman)
Zion Swader (Siegel)
Braden Siren (Riverdale)
D.D. Anderson (Oakland)
Donovan Jackson (Stewart's Creek)
Tanner Staggs (Lawrence County)
